CC750S Brass vs. C61500 Bronze

Both CC750S brass and C61500 bronze are copper alloys. They have 65%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is CC750S brass and the bottom bar is C61500 bronze.

Mechanical Properties

Elastic (Young's, Tensile) Modulus, GPa 110
110
Elongation at Break, % 13
3.0 to 55
Poisson's Ratio 0.31
0.34
Shear Modulus, GPa 40
42
Tensile Strength: Ultimate (UTS), MPa 200
480 to 970
Tensile Strength: Yield (Proof), MPa 80
150 to 720

Thermal Properties

Latent Heat of Fusion, J/g 170
220
Maximum Temperature: Mechanical, °C 130
220
Melting Completion (Liquidus), °C 860
1040
Melting Onset (Solidus), °C 810
1030
Specific Heat Capacity, J/kg-K 380
430
Thermal Conductivity, W/m-K 110
58
Thermal Expansion, µm/m-K 20
18

Electrical Properties

Electrical Conductivity: Equal Volume, % IACS 24
13
Electrical Conductivity: Equal Weight (Specific), % IACS 26
13

Alloy Composition

Aluminum (Al), % 0 to 0.1
7.7 to 8.3
Copper (Cu), % 62 to 67
89 to 90.5
Iron (Fe), % 0 to 0.8
0
Lead (Pb), % 1.0 to 3.0
0 to 0.015
Manganese (Mn), % 0 to 0.2
0
Nickel (Ni), % 0 to 1.0
1.8 to 2.2
Phosphorus (P), % 0 to 0.050
0
Silicon (Si), % 0 to 0.050
0
Tin (Sn), % 0 to 1.5
0
Zinc (Zn), % 26.3 to 36
0
Residuals, % 0
0 to 0.5
